Skip to content

Commit

Permalink
fix bug (apache#13590)
Browse files Browse the repository at this point in the history
  • Loading branch information
shuwenwei authored Sep 24, 2024
1 parent acda1a0 commit cb4befc
Showing 1 changed file with 1 addition and 2 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-880,7 +880,6 @@ private void recoverSealedTsFiles(
new SealedTsFileRecoverPerformer(sealedTsFile)) {
recoverPerformer.recover();
sealedTsFile.close();
tsFileManager.add(sealedTsFile, isSeq);
tsFileResourceManager.registerSealedTsFileResource(sealedTsFile);
} catch (Throwable e) {
logger.error("Fail to recover sealed TsFile {}, skip it.", sealedTsFile.getTsFilePath(), e);
Expand All @@ -900,10 +899,10 @@ private Callable<Void> recoverFilesInPartition(
List<TsFileResource> resourceListForSyncRecover = new ArrayList<>();
Callable<Void> asyncRecoverTask = null;
for (TsFileResource tsFileResource : resourceList) {
tsFileManager.add(tsFileResource, isSeq);
if (fileTimeIndexMap.containsKey(tsFileResource.getTsFileID())) {
tsFileResource.setTimeIndex(fileTimeIndexMap.get(tsFileResource.getTsFileID()));
tsFileResource.setStatus(TsFileResourceStatus.NORMAL);
tsFileManager.add(tsFileResource, isSeq);
resourceListForAsyncRecover.add(tsFileResource);
} else {
resourceListForSyncRecover.add(tsFileResource);
Expand Down

0 comments on commit cb4befc

Please sign in to comment.